首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Webpack -找不到模块原始加载器

Webpack是一个现代化的静态模块打包工具,它主要用于将多个模块打包成一个或多个静态资源文件。它是前端开发中非常重要的工具之一,可以帮助开发者管理和优化项目中的各种资源。

Webpack的主要功能包括模块打包、代码分割、资源优化、代码转换等。它支持多种模块化规范,如CommonJS、AMD、ES6模块等,并且可以通过加载器(loader)和插件(plugins)的方式进行扩展和定制。

在Webpack中,模块是指项目中的各个文件,可以是JavaScript文件、CSS文件、图片文件等。通过配置文件或命令行参数,Webpack可以根据模块之间的依赖关系,将它们打包成一个或多个静态资源文件,以供浏览器加载和解析。

对于找不到模块原始加载器的问题,可能是由于以下几个原因导致的:

  1. 模块加载器未安装:Webpack需要使用相应的加载器来处理不同类型的模块,如果没有安装对应的加载器,就会找不到模块原始加载器。解决方法是通过npm安装对应的加载器,例如使用npm install css-loader安装CSS加载器。
  2. 配置文件错误:Webpack的配置文件(通常是webpack.config.js)中可能存在错误配置,导致找不到模块原始加载器。可以检查配置文件中的加载器配置是否正确,并确保加载器的路径和名称正确。
  3. 模块路径错误:在项目中引用模块时,可能存在路径错误导致找不到模块原始加载器。可以检查引用模块的路径是否正确,并确保模块的加载器正确配置。

总结起来,解决找不到模块原始加载器的问题,可以通过安装对应的加载器、检查配置文件和模块路径来排查和解决。如果问题仍然存在,可以参考Webpack官方文档或社区中的相关资源进行更深入的排查和解决。

腾讯云提供了一系列与Webpack相关的产品和服务,例如云函数SCF(Serverless Cloud Function)、云开发Cloudbase、云托管Tencent CloudBase等,它们可以与Webpack结合使用,提供更便捷的部署和运行环境。具体产品介绍和文档可以参考以下链接:

  1. 云函数SCF:https://cloud.tencent.com/product/scf
  2. 云开发Cloudbase:https://cloud.tencent.com/product/cloudbase
  3. 云托管Tencent CloudBase:https://cloud.tencent.com/product/tcb
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券